Independent: A war without end?

Any illusion that the occupation might be working lies in the ruins of the UN's HQ
More British soldiers are dead. The UN building is reduced to rubble. An oil pipeline is bombed. Water is cut off and the only law is that of the gun. No one can pretend the occupation is bringing peace and democracy. Yet the US, eager to blame 'foreign' terrorists, will not admit that Iraqi resistance is organised and growing
